Write a recursive method that returns the number of 1s in the binary representation of n (an integer parameter to your method). Use the fact that the number of ones in n equals the number of 1s in the binary representation of n/2, plus 1, if n is odd. (Note that you don't add 1 ton/2. You add one to the number of 1s in the binary representation of n/2.) The answer for 25 would be 3, since the binary representation is 11001. For negative numbers, return the number of ones in the absolute value
